Workbench Storage Solutions

Regularly, you'll find yourself scrambling to locate that one screw or wrench amidst the chaos of your workbench, but with the right storage solutions, you can reclaim your workspace and get back to tinkering in no time.

Mobile workbench solutions can help you stay organized, providing hidden storage compartments to stash small parts and tools. Look for workbenches with built-in drawers, shelves, or cabinets to keep everything within easy reach.

Integrated power outlets on your workbench can also save you time and hassle, allowing you to plug in your tools and devices without having to worry about cords getting in the way.

Adjustable height workbenches can be a game-changer, too, letting you customize your workspace to fit your needs. Whether you're working on a small engine or a large project, having the flexibility to adjust the height of your workbench can reduce strain and improve productivity.

Smart Bike Storage Options

With your prized bikes taking center stage in your garage, ensuring to invest in smart bike storage options that protect them from damage and keep them organized, freeing up valuable floor space for other activities.

A smart rack is an excellent solution, allowing you to store multiple bikes in a compact footprint. Look for a rack with adjustable arms to accommodate different bike sizes and styles. This will keep your bikes secure and prevent scratches or dings.

Alternatively, consider a wall mount storage system, which takes advantage of your garage's vertical space. This sleek and modern solution allows you to store your bikes flat against the wall, keeping them out of the way while still being easily accessible. When choosing a wall mount, make sure it's sturdy and can hold the weight of your bikes.

Utilizing Ceiling Storage

As you're revamping your garage, don't forget to look up - literally! You're sitting on a treasure trove of unused space above your head, just waiting to be tapped.

Maximize Vertical Space

Take advantage of your garage's often-wasted overhead real estate by incorporating ceiling storage solutions that will keep your prized possessions organized and out of the way. You'll be amazed at how much more space you'll gain by maximizing your vertical storage.

Here are three ways to get started:

  1. Install hanging hooks for your bikes, kayaks, or other bulky items that are taking up valuable floor space. This won't only free up room but also protect your gear from damage.

  2. Utilize ladder storage by attaching a ladder rack to your ceiling. This is perfect for storing infrequently used ladders, making them easily accessible when you need them.

  3. Add overhead bins for storing seasonal decorations, camping gear, or other items that you only need occasionally. Label each bin so you can quickly find what you're looking for.
